“…This concept was first proposed by Ulich about 80 years ago to calculate the solvation number of ions in water. [17] He essentially assumed that the water in the first solvation shell of the ion is immobilized similarly to water in an ice crystal. Later Marcus adopted this approach for the determination of solvation numbers in non-aqueous solvents.…”

“…Substitution of a methyl group for the hydrogen atom in hydrogen cyanide seems to improve the donor properties of the nitrogen atom. A coordination compound between acetonitrile and boron trichloride, CH3CN -BCls, has been reported by Nespital and coworkers (46,61,62). It is a white crystalline compound melting at 169°C.…”
